sourcepub fn new(n: usize) -> Option<Self>
pub fn new(n: usize) -> Option<Self>
This function allocates a workspace for computing eigenvalues of n-by-n complex generalized hermitian-definite eigensystems. The size of the workspace is O(3n).

pub fn genherm( &mut self, A: MatrixComplexF64, B: &mut MatrixComplexF64, eval: &mut VectorF64 ) -> Result<(), Value>
This function computes the eigenvalues of the complex generalized hermitian-definite matrix
pair (A, B), and stores them in eval
, using the method outlined above. On output, B
contains its Cholesky decomposition and A
is destroyed.
